It arrived on 9 Aug, around 1pm! I read a few reviews in FB said that the delivery wasn't on time and they waited for a whole long day and still haven't receive, called the courier and the courier said 1 more hour, but after 1 hour still haven't receive.. so on and so on. Thank God my order was so straightforward. I just waited at home and then the door bell rang at 1pm. Saw the Ta-Q-Bin van outside waiting. I knew it was the cake! Received it cold and ice. They freeze it so that it won't spoil after a day of traveling from JB to KL. Awesome!

 
Look at this beauty!! Couldn't wait to cut.. but it was so hard like an ice because they freeze it.

 
The beautiful layers of the crepe, layered with generous amount of cream. 

 
Finally, able to cut after using much force. So afraid my knife will break into half. Haha. Cut a few portions, and keep the rest back in the freezer.

This is half frozen. If you eat it like this, it tastes a lot like ice cream. I waited a while more, roughly about 20mins in room temperature and it tasted really good. But I couldn't taste if it was real musang or not, which I doubt it is. The durian is blended with the cream therefore, couldn't taste much of the durian flesh. More towards the smell only.
